Klohn Crippen Berger is Hiring a Senior Water Resources Engineer Near Vancouver, WA

Senior Water Resources EngineerVancouver Are you looking for an opportunity to…Work on some of the largest tailings dams in the world?Work with a group of highly motivated like-minded professionals?Mentor a team of highly motivated individuals?Leave a positive impact on the environment and communities?Solve some of the most complex problems faced by the mining industry?Intrigued? Read on - the details of your next career adventure are below.What makes us stand out? Aren’t all consultancies the same? We don’t think so. One of our tag lines “Down to Earth / Up to the Challenge” says a lot about who we are. In broad terms we think KCB’s primary differentiators are:our global reputation for technical excellenceappetite to tackle problems with unique complexitiesour size (we’re a mid-sized consultancy)the breadth of our multi-disciplinary servicesWhat you would engage in:Our focus is on the application of critical thinking to the management of mine waste and water. If continuing your career journey with us, you would be part of our Mining Environmental Group, based out our Vancouver office. The role of Senior Water Resources Engineer comes with the flexibility to work a hybrid schedule and will provide you with the opportunity to: Engage with clients, colleagues and suppliers on environmentally focused field programs and design solutionsConduct hydrological and hydraulic analysis, including flood mapping, water balance analysis, and hydraulic modellingSupport mine water management design and optimizationBuild client rapport that develops projects from feasibility through to mine closure phasesExpand your knowledge by attending conferences and trainingsCoordinate with other engineering disciplines to ensure integration of water management systems into overall design and operationPrepare technical reports, proposals, and other documentation related to water resources engineeringBe an ambassador for and potentially become an owner of KCB What we require:We respect the knowledge and experience you have gained to date and are willing to help you build on it. We do however require the following qualifications: A degree in civil engineering, with a track record of continued developmentAt least eight years’ civil design experience related to surface water controls for mining projects You must be eligible to register as professional engineer in CanadaExperience in slope stability and seepage analysis; dam design; earthworks and constructionAn ability to build relationships with multidisciplinary project-based teamsExperience in a safety focused environment with near miss and incident reporting requirementsIn addition to the must have requirements you will excel in the role if you have the following:An ability to find creative solutions and know how to present themA willingness to mentor others and be mentoredAn ability to build rapport with clients, colleagues, and industry partnersDemonstrate that you are flexible and seek solutions rather than focus on problems The salary for this position is $110,000 to $150,000 per year. Salary is based on applicable experience, education, and skill level.
